When is the Best Time to Start a Skincare Routine?

skincare

Navigating parenthood involves a myriad of decisions, each shaping the journey of raising healthy, happy children. One such decision revolves around when to introduce your child to a skincare routine. As parents, we recognize the importance of instilling good habits early, especially in skincare, which plays a vital role in overall well-being and confidence.

Why Start a Skincare Routine Early?

  1. Establishing Lifelong Habits: Introducing a routine during childhood lays the groundwork for lifelong habits that promote healthy skin. By starting early, children learn the importance of regular care practices, such as cleansing, moisturizing, and sun protection, which are essential for maintaining skin health throughout their lives.
  2. Sun Protection: Teaching children about sunscreen application and removal is crucial for protecting their skin from harmful UV rays. It’s not just about preventing sunburns; consistent sun protection reduces the risk of long-term damage and premature aging.
  3. Addressing Early Skin Changes: With children experiencing puberty at younger ages, early skin changes like oiliness and occasional breakouts may occur. A structured skincare routine can help manage these changes effectively, promoting clear, balanced skin and boosting self-confidence.
  4. Preparation for Teenage Years: Starting a skincare routine early prepares children for the more complex skincare challenges they may face as teenagers. It equips them with essential knowledge about their skin type, common skin issues, and how to care for their skin properly.
  5. Encouraging Positive Experiences: Making skincare routines enjoyable and engaging can motivate children to embrace these habits willingly. Choosing products with appealing packaging, gentle formulations, and involving them in the selection process can create positive associations from an early age.

Effective Skincare Practices:

  • Gentle Formulations: Opt for skincare products specifically designed for children’s delicate skin. Look for gentle cleansers, moisturizers, and sunscreens that are free from harsh chemicals and allergens.
  • Consistency: Consistency is key to skincare success. Encourage your child to follow a daily routine that includes morning and evening steps, reinforcing the importance of regularity in skincare habits.
  • Education and Guidance: Educate your child about the benefits of each skincare step, from cleansing to moisturizing. Teach them how to apply sunscreen correctly and stress the importance of removing it thoroughly at the end of the day.
  • Monitoring and Adjusting: Monitor your child’s skin response to the skincare routine and make adjustments as needed. Every child’s skin is unique, so be attentive to any sensitivities or changes that may require modifications in products or routines.
